Transaction 20f4361159f829d9c10043622e5153b2c4d629f964ca3c8759a910934c4518b5
2 Input
2 Outputs
- 20f4361159f829d9c10043622e5153b2c4d629f964ca3c8759a910934c4518b5:0
- 20f4361159f829d9c10043622e5153b2c4d629f964ca3c8759a910934c4518b5:1
value 45464217
address 3ADFr6VTgw1fNvFoAxDFBDQczNS1W3sGj9
value 14855468
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n